Hi there,
You’re welcome to directly contact our Jetpack support team or email WordPress.com support for help with this. (Please only contact us using one of those methods; our team replies via email in the order support requests are received.)
Also, just a note if any of the sites are still active: If you want a site removed from your account, but somebody else is still using the site, removing it from our end will cause the site stats and other Jetpack features to stop working.
Instead, the new site owner can go to the Jetpack menu in their dashboard, disconnect it, and then re-connect it with their own WordPress.com account. That way, the new owner will be able to maintain the stats history and their Jetpack features will continue working with no interruptions. It will also remove the site from your account.
